Output 59f900005dda4b948af0afe45ab1b66bbd35519c45a6651c0bd3a29a6049529d:3

value
70655132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ebddd7b385c88bb55cae7a73c8f39f2ab014cb3 OP_EQUAL
address
M9F79BJjmT4h62fSJUPh4xxkRZNKj5Qomr
transaction
59f900005dda4b948af0afe45ab1b66bbd35519c45a6651c0bd3a29a6049529d
spent
true